DRAIN AND RENEW
TRANSFER GEARBOX
OIL
1. Drive vehicle to level ground and place a container
beneath the gearbox to catch the old oil.
2. Remove the drain plug and allow time for the oil to
drain completely.
3. Clean and refit the drain plug using a new washer,
if necessary and tighten to the correct torque.
4. Remove the oil filler-level plug and inject the
approximate quantity
of
a recommended
oil until it
begins to run from the hole. Clean and fit the plug
and tighten to the correct torque.
Do
not
overtighten. Wipe away any surplus oil.
RENEW FRONT
AND REAR AXLE OIL
1. Drive the vehicle to level ground and place a
container under the axle to be drained.
2. Using a spanner with a
13
(0.5
in) square drive
remove the drain plug and allow the oil to drain
completely. Clean and refit the drain plug.
Remove the oil filler-level plug and inject new oil
of a recommended make and grade until it begins
to run from the hole. Clean and fit the filler-level
plug and wipe away any
surplus oil.
NOTE: Whilst the illustration shows a ‘90’ model
front differential, the procedure is the same for all
axles.

RENEW SWIVEL PIN HOUSING
OIL
1. Drive the vehicle to level ground and place a
container under each swivel housing to catch the
used
oil.
2. Remove the drain plug and allow the oil to drain
completely and clean and refit the plugs.
3. Remove the oil filler-level plug and inject the
recommended make and grade
of oil until oil
begins to run from the level hole. Clean and fit the
level plugs and wipe away any surplus oil.
LUBRICATE PROPELLER SHAFTS
1. Clean all the grease nipples on the front and rear
propshaft universal joints, and sliding portion of
the rear shaft.
2 . Charge a low pressure hand grease gun with grease
of
a recommended make and grade and apply to
the grease nipples.
3. Remove the screwed plug from the front
shaft and
fit
a suitable grease nipple.
4. Disconnect one end of the front propeller shaft and
compress the sliding portion whilst applying
grease. It is necessary to compress the shaft to
prevent
filling with grease.
It
should be noted
that this sliding portion must only be lubricated at
40.000
(24,000
mile) intervals.

TOP-UP MANUAL STEERING
BOX
1. Remove the oil filler plug and observe the oil level
which should be
25
(1.0
in) below the top of
the filler hole.
2. If necessary top-up to the correct level with a
recommended oil. Clean and refit the plug and
wipe away any surplus oil.
